Hydrogen.

From Greek hydros (water) and genius (generator). Name given by Lavoisier. Discovered in 1766 by Henry Cavendish, who called it flammable air and proved that water resulted from the combination of this element with oxygen.

Most abundant element in the Universe, in which it participates with 90% by weight. In the Earth's atmosphere it is found free in small quantities (only 0.5 ppm in volume). In the combined state, it appears mainly in the form of water. It is present in the composition of practically all organic compounds. In the earth's crust, it is the ninth most abundant element (0.88% by weight).

Applications:
2 Combustible gas (hydrogen torches). Manufacture of ammonia (NH3), methyl alcohol (CH3OH) and many other compounds of great industrial importance. Margarine manufacture (hydrogenation of vegetable oils).

As the hydrogen compounds are very numerous, their main applications have been mentioned in those of the element (s) with which it is combined. Example: the applications of NH 3 were mentioned in those of nitrogen compounds.

 

Periodic Properties Table:

Atomic Mass: 1,0079 u

Density (25 ºC): 0.090 g / L (CNTP)

Ionization Energy: 1311 kJ / mol

Melting Point: -259 ºC

Boiling Point: -252 ºC

Atomic Radius: 37 pm

Electronegativity: 2.20
